logo

DeepSeek模型版本解析:从基础架构到技术演进的全景图

作者:十万个为什么2025.09.25 22:23浏览量:0

简介:本文深度解析DeepSeek模型各版本的核心差异,涵盖架构设计、性能优化及应用场景,为开发者提供技术选型与迁移的实用指南。

一、版本划分的核心逻辑:技术迭代与场景适配

DeepSeek模型的版本划分并非简单的数字递增,而是基于架构优化性能提升场景扩展三大维度的技术演进。以DeepSeek-V1到DeepSeek-V3为例,版本升级主要解决三个核心问题:

  1. 计算效率瓶颈:早期版本(如V1)采用Transformer基础架构,在长序列处理时存在显存占用过高的问题。V2通过引入稀疏注意力机制,将计算复杂度从O(n²)降至O(n log n),使模型能处理更长的文本(如从2K tokens扩展至16K tokens)。
  2. 多模态融合需求:V2.5版本新增跨模态注意力模块,支持文本与图像的联合编码。例如,在医疗场景中,模型可同时解析CT影像报告和患者病历,输出综合诊断建议。
  3. 企业级部署挑战:V3针对私有化部署需求,优化了模型量化方案。通过4bit量化技术,模型参数量从13B压缩至3.25B,在保持90%以上精度的同时,推理速度提升3倍。

技术验证示例
在代码层面,V3的量化实现可通过以下PyTorch片段体现:

  1. import torch
  2. from transformers import AutoModelForCausalLM
  3. model = AutoModelForCausalLM.from_pretrained("deepseek/v3-4bit")
  4. quantizer = torch.quantization.QuantStub()
  5. model.qconfig = torch.quantization.get_default_qat_qconfig('fbgemm')
  6. prepared_model = torch.quantization.prepare_qat(model)
  7. quantized_model = torch.quantization.convert(prepared_model)

此代码展示了从FP16到INT4的量化转换过程,验证了V3在资源受限环境下的部署能力。

二、版本差异的技术细节:从参数到架构的全面对比

1. 基础架构演进

版本 注意力机制 层数 参数量 典型应用场景
V1 标准Transformer 12 1.3B 通用文本生成
V2 稀疏注意力 24 6.7B 文档处理、知识问答
V2.5 跨模态注意力 32 13B 多模态内容理解
V3 动态稀疏注意力 48 67B 企业级私有化部署

关键突破:V3的动态稀疏注意力通过门控机制动态调整注意力权重,例如在金融分析场景中,模型可自动聚焦于财报中的关键指标(如ROE、负债率),忽略无关信息。

2. 性能优化策略

  • 硬件适配:V3针对NVIDIA A100/H100 GPU优化了张量核(Tensor Core)利用率,使FP16推理速度达到每秒380 tokens(V1仅为120 tokens)。
  • 内存管理:通过参数共享技术,V2.5将嵌入层参数量减少40%,使单卡可加载模型从V1的20B提升至50B。
  • 训练效率:V3采用3D并行训练(数据并行+模型并行+流水线并行),将千亿参数模型的训练时间从V1的30天缩短至7天。

三、版本选型的决策框架:需求驱动的技术匹配

开发者在选择版本时,需综合考虑以下因素:

  1. 资源约束

    • 边缘设备部署:优先选择V2(6.7B参数)或量化后的V3(3.25B参数)。
    • 云服务部署:V3(67B参数)可提供最佳精度,但需配备8张A100 GPU。
  2. 任务复杂度

    • 简单文本生成:V1已足够(如客服机器人)。
    • 多模态任务:必须选择V2.5及以上版本(如图像描述生成)。
  3. 数据隐私要求

    • 私有化部署:V3支持联邦学习模式,可在不共享原始数据的情况下完成模型微调。
    • 公开数据训练:V1/V2可满足大多数场景需求。

实践建议

  • 渐进式迁移:从V1升级到V2时,建议先在测试集上验证稀疏注意力对任务精度的影响(通常损失<2%)。
  • 量化评估:使用WPS(Weighted Perplexity Score)指标评估量化后的模型质量,确保WPS下降不超过5%。

四、未来版本的技术趋势:从效率到智能的跨越

根据DeepSeek官方路线图,下一代版本(V4)将聚焦三大方向:

  1. 自适应架构:模型可根据输入动态调整层数和注意力头数,例如处理简单问题时自动切换为浅层网络
  2. 工具增强学习:集成API调用能力,使模型能自主调用计算器、数据库等外部工具(如deepseek.tools.calculate("3.14*5^2"))。
  3. 持续学习:通过弹性权重巩固(EWC)技术,实现模型在不遗忘旧知识的前提下学习新任务。

开发者行动清单

  1. 监控DeepSeek GitHub仓库的release标签,获取版本升级通知。
  2. 参与Hugging Face的模型评测计划,获取免费算力支持。
  3. 关注NeurIPS/ICML等顶会论文,提前布局下一代技术。

本文通过技术架构、性能数据和场景案例,系统解析了DeepSeek模型版本的演进逻辑。对于开发者而言,理解版本差异不仅是技术选型的基础,更是优化资源投入、提升业务价值的关键。随着模型能力的不断突破,持续跟踪版本更新将成为AI工程化的核心能力之一。

相关文章推荐

发表评论

活动